摘要
球载雷达对球上设备质量范围要求较高,为了达到设计指标,天线采用轻质碳纤维复合材料以减轻质量。利用HYPEMESH和ANSYS对天线骨架进行力学分析,在力学分析的基础上,充分利用复合材料的可设计性,设计出符合要求的轻质碳纤维复合材料天线。同时总结了大尺寸、轻质碳纤维复合材料天线一些设计经验。
